The Wasilla Warriors earned an overtime win over one of their biggest rivals.

Branson Starheim scored less than a minute into the extra frame to give Wasilla a 4-3 overtime win over Palmer Tuesday night at the Brett Memorial Ice Arena in Wasilla.

It was Starheim’s second goal of the game. He also scored in the first minute of the second period to give the Warriors a 1-0 lead. Karson McGrew and Mason Holler also scored for the Warriors.

Xander Logan, Chase Ringler and Brandon Horacek scored for the Moose.

Palmer outshot Wasilla 24-23. Kole Kite made 21 saves for the Warriors in the win. Brody Joseph made 19 saves for the Moose.
